Abstract

The utility model discloses a shaft transmission connection device of a roll type crusher. The shaft transmission connection device comprises a roll wheel (1), a roll wheel supporting bearing (2), a geneva wheel (3) and a motor, wherein an elastic taper sleeve (6) is arranged between the roll wheel (1), the geneva wheel (3) and roll wheel supporting bearing (2), a pressure plate (4) is arranged outside the elastic taper sleeve (6). The shaft transmission connection device is simple in structure and convenient to operate, and by screwing up screws on the pressure plate (4), the problems of unstable shaft transmission, and loosened transmission belt of the roll type crusher due to large transmission torque, machine vibration and the like can be effectively solved.

Background technology
Kibbler roll is a kind of very ancient disintegrating apparatus, due to simple structure, easy to operate, be widely used in the industrial departments such as cement, chemical industry, electric power, metallurgy, building materials, refractory material, with the medium-hard material of fragmentation, as operation broken, in small, broken bits in the materials such as lime stone, slag, coke, coal.According to specification, divide, kibbler roll is divided into oppositely rolling roller crusher, four-roller type disintegrating machine and toothed roll crusher, mainly parts such as running roller, running roller spring bearing, compression and adjusting device and drive units, consists of.Aspect transmission, kibbler roll generally connects to carry out through-drive with key at present; due to reasons such as the moment of kibbler roll transmission is large, machine vibrations; key on axle often has intermittently and causes transmission not steady; driving belt also there will be and loosening causes transmission tired; for guaranteeing reliable and stable transmission; often need to change power transmission shaft or driving belt, waste time and energy, operating efficiency is not high yet simultaneously.
Summary of the invention
The technical problems to be solved in the utility model: provide a kind of kibbler roll through-drive jockey, to solve kibbler roll because the through-drive that the reasons such as driving torque is large, machine vibration cause is steady, the loosening problem of driving belt.
The technical solution of the utility model:
A kind of kibbler roll through-drive jockey, comprises running roller, running roller spring bearing, sheave and motor, between running roller, sheave and running roller spring bearing, is provided with elastic conical drogue, at elastic conical drogue, is provided with pressure strip outward.
Above-mentioned elastic conical drogue comprises interior ring and outer shroud.
Aforesaid interior ring outer surface cone angle is 12.5 °~17 °.
Aforesaid outer ring inner surface cone angle is 12.5 °~17 °.
Aforesaid elastic conical drogue adopts high-carbon steel or structural alloy steel to make.
Aforesaid pressure strip is screwed on running roller or sheave.
The beneficial effects of the utility model:
A kind of crusher shaft transmission joint of the utility model, changes traditional key by running roller, sheave and the transmission of running roller spring bearing and is connected to elastic conical drogue and is connected, and with pressure strip, elastic conical drogue is compressed simultaneously.Because elastic ring connects, be to utilize the connection that the inside and outside steel loop between propeller boss forms with conical surface laminating jam-packed, therefore when driving torque weakness or driving belt are loosening, can be by screw-driving to produce axial pressing force, thereby interior ring and outer shroud on elastic conical drogue are pushed against, interior ring dwindles and banding axle, outer shroud swells and stretching hub, so just can solve the problem that through-drive is unstable or belt is loosening.Compared with prior art, the utility model can transmit larger moment of torsion and axial force, there is no stress raiser simultaneously, and centering property is good, and mounting or dismounting are convenient, successful.

the specific embodiment:
Embodiment:
As Fig. 1 to Fig. 3, a kind of crusher shaft transmission joint of the utility model, with high-carbon steel and to make cone angle through heat treatment be interior ring 8 and the outer shroud 7 of 15 °, then interior ring 8 and outer shroud 7 are put together and are arranged between running roller 1, sheave 3 and running roller spring bearing 2, interior ring 8 contacts with running roller spring bearing 2, outer shroud 7 contacts with running roller 1, then at pressure strip 4 of the outer installation of elastic conical drogue 6, pressure strip 4 use screws 5 are fixed on running roller 1 or sheave 3.
During use, if discovery transmission is steady or driving belt has loosening phenomenon, screw 5 can be tightened.
